How AI-Powered Voice Recognition Can Combat Physician Burnout

The relentless demands of modern medicine, coupled with growing administrative burdens, have driven physician burnout to critical levels. A major contributor to this issue is clinical documentation—a necessary but time-intensive task. Enter AI-powered voice recognition, a transformative technology that moves beyond outdated dictation software. These advanced systems can distinguish multiple speakers, understand complex medical terminology, and integrate seamlessly with electronic health records (EHRs). By automating documentation, AI scribes reduce administrative strain, allowing physicians to focus on patient care and reconnect with the human side of medicine.

 

Top Features of AI Medical Scribes for Busy Practices

When selecting an AI medical scribe, look for features that go beyond basic dictation to streamline workflows and enhance patient care. The best systems offer advanced capabilities tailored to the needs of a fast-paced practice:

  • Ambient Listening: Passively captures clinical details from patient encounters without requiring active dictation, enabling natural interactions.
  • EHR Integration: Automatically populates patient charts with accurate, structured data, saving time and minimizing errors.
  • Real-Time Clinical Decision Support: Provides insights and alerts during encounters, such as drug interaction warnings or diagnostic suggestions.
  • Natural Language Processing (NLP): Interprets and organizes clinical information from conversational language with high accuracy.
  • HIPAA Compliance: Ensures robust security and privacy for patient data, meeting regulatory standards.

Mastering Complex Medical Terminology with AI

Accurate transcription of medical terminology is critical, as even minor errors can impact patient care. Modern AI voice recognition systems excel here, trained on vast datasets including medical literature, clinical notes, and patient encounters. This enables them to:

  • Recognize and transcribe complex terms like “hypertension” versus “hypotension” with contextual accuracy.
  • Continuously learn and adapt to evolving medical terminology through machine learning algorithms.
  • Outperform general-purpose voice recognition tools, which lack the specialized training required for clinical settings.

Think of AI as a perpetual medical student, rapidly mastering the nuances of specialty-specific language and staying current with advancements in the field.

The ROI of AI Medical Scribes

While the upfront cost of an AI medical scribe may seem significant, the return on investment (ROI) is substantial, offering both financial and operational benefits:

  • Time Savings: Studies show physicians spend up to two hours on administrative tasks for every hour of patient care. AI scribes drastically reduce this burden, allowing more time for patient visits or complex cases.
  • Improved Billing Accuracy: Detailed, accurate clinical notes enhance coding precision, reducing claim denials and maximizing reimbursements.
  • Reduced Burnout and Turnover: By alleviating administrative stress, AI scribes improve physician well-being, lowering turnover costs.

When calculating ROI, consider not only direct financial gains but also long-term improvements in efficiency, physician satisfaction, and patient care quality.

Security and Privacy Considerations for AI Scribes

Handling protected health information (PHI) demands stringent security measures. When evaluating AI medical scribes, prioritize:

  • HIPAA Compliance: Ensure end-to-end encryption, secure cloud storage, and strict access controls.
  • Vendor Transparency: Review data storage, retention policies, and breach response procedures.
  • Legal Oversight: Have your compliance team evaluate the vendor’s terms of service and business associate agreement (BAA).

By selecting a secure, compliant solution, you can confidently leverage AI while safeguarding patient privacy.

The Future of AI Voice Recognition in Medicine

AI voice recognition is poised to transform healthcare further with cutting-edge advancements:

  • Real-Time Clinical Support: Future AI scribes may provide instant alerts, such as flagging drug interactions or suggesting diagnostics based on patient data.
  • Voice Biomarker Analysis: Emerging research explores how vocal changes can detect conditions like Parkinson’s or depression, enabling earlier diagnoses during routine visits.
  • Continuous Innovation: Ongoing advancements in AI will enhance accuracy, integration, and clinical utility.

How do ambient AI medical scribes work with EHRs during a patient visit?

Unlike traditional dictation software that requires you to actively speak into a microphone, an ambient AI medical scribe works passively in the background during a patient consultation. The AI-powered system listens to the natural conversation between you and your patient, automatically identifying and structuring clinically relevant information in real-time. It then populates this information directly into the appropriate sections of your Electronic Health Record (EHR), such as the HPI, assessment, and plan, often in a SOAP note format. This seamless integration with major EHRs like Epic and Cerner means you can focus entirely on the patient without the distraction of a screen or keyboard. What are the key considerations for integrating AI voice recognition with my practice's existing EHR system?

Successful integration is critical for maximizing the benefits of AI voice recognition. The primary consideration is compatibility; you need to ensure the AI solution offers robust, pre-built integrations for your specific EHR, whether it's a major platform like Cerner and Epic or a specialty-specific system. Look for solutions that use modern standards like FHIR for more flexible integration options. Another key factor is the workflow—the best systems don't just transcribe text but intelligently place structured data into the correct fields within the patient chart, from progress notes to order entry. Finally, inquire about the vendor's implementation and support process to handle potential challenges like template mismatches or user authentication.
